Tyla Seethal Becomes First African Solo Artist to Hit 1 Billion Spotify Streams with 'Water'
February 21, 2025
Tyla Seethal has made history as the first African solo artist to reach 1 billion streams on Spotify with her hit song 'Water', which has become a cultural phenomenon.
The success of 'Water' marks a significant milestone for South African music, setting a precedent for future artists from the continent.
This accomplishment further solidifies Tyla's status as a prominent figure in the music industry, reflecting her rising stardom and the popularity of her music.
At just 23 years old, Tyla has quickly risen to global fame, largely due to the viral success of 'Water' on TikTok in 2023.
Her accolades include winning a Grammy and being the first South African to win a VMA, showcasing her exceptional talent.
Recently, Tyla released a remix of 'Push 2 Start' featuring Sean Paul, which has generated excitement among her global fanbase.
Tyla's influence extends beyond music; she recently graced the cover of British Vogue, where she was described as music's most intoxicating new mononym.
Phiona Okumu, Head of Music at Spotify, noted that Tyla's success serves as an inspiration to aspiring artists across Africa and the world.
Her journey exemplifies the growing influence and recognition of African artists in the global music industry.
Will Smith has praised Tyla, referring to her as the first real African pop star, highlighting the global attention she has garnered.
Despite the pressures of fame, Tyla has navigated her career with poise, distinguishing herself from her predecessors.
Additionally, 'Water' has achieved both Platinum and double Platinum status in record time, further emphasizing its historic impact.
